  • I encourage you to wear clothes that you love and feel comfortable in. If you need some guidance on how to style your family, here are some of my inspiration for you.

    For indoor and outdoor session:

    Moms, I will start with you. I would pick your favourite outfit, a pretty dress that you feel good in, or this is a perfect excuse for you to buy a beautiful outfit for yourself. Based on the colours of your outfit, you can coordinate it with your loved ones. Everyone doesn't need to match, like wearing all white, or all black. It would be nice to have different patterns, textures, colours for every family member.

    In-home/Indoor session: i find that neutral, earthy, lighter coloured clothing looks best for indoor photos. Textures and patterns are encouraged as long it's not too overwhelming as we do not want to clothing to draw attention away from you. Also, try to avoid clothing with logos and too bright colours like red for newborns as it gives a red colour cast on skintones

    For outdoor: I have a lot of my outdoor photo sessions in nature with green foliage, thus complementary colours like orange and red will work well to stand out. Nuetral, earthy apparal work well as well if you prefer natural and minimalized look.

  • It is during golden hour, which is one hour after the sun rises and one hour before the sun sets. The timing varies depending on the seasons, during autumn months, the sun sets earlier and thus golden hour starts from 5pm to 6pm. I understand that the evening golden hour may be difficult for babies and toddlers, however, this magical hour will be so worth it. A good tip for parents would be to try to get their kids to nap a bit later during the day or have some quiet time. Most of the kids are excited to be able to go out during that time and the fact that they are in nature, it calms them down. Trust me, the golden bokehs, and sun flares will be so worth it even if you need to change their routine for just one day.

  • It's good to have them done under 2 weeks, as we can get some peaceful sleepy shots that we all want to remember. Also, i find babies do get a bit of hormonal rash after the 2 weeks mark. Don't worry if you miss the 2 weeks, as any memories captured with your family would be priceless, so if you want family photos at 1 month, it would be as amazing as the newborn phase.

  • Awake newborns are adorable too! I like to go with the flow with them and try to go with their cues. If baby prefers to be cuddled in parent's arms, i will conduct the whole session with you holding your baby.
